The distribution of size of files (measured in lines of code).
File | # lines | # units |
---|---|---|
template.yaml in root |
416 | - |
StripeBillingPublish.java in src/main/java/com/amazonaws/partners/saasfactory/metering/aggregation |
337 | 10 |
BillingEventAggregation.java in src/main/java/com/amazonaws/partners/saasfactory/metering/aggregation |
317 | 11 |
TenantConfiguration.java in src/main/java/com/amazonaws/partners/saasfactory/metering/common |
162 | 7 |
ProcessBillingEvent.java in src/main/java/com/amazonaws/partners/saasfactory/metering/billing |
139 | 5 |
Constants.java in src/main/java/com/amazonaws/partners/saasfactory/metering/common |
119 | 8 |
OnboardNewTenant.java in src/main/java/com/amazonaws/partners/saasfactory/metering/onboarding |
113 | 5 |
BillingEvent.java in src/main/java/com/amazonaws/partners/saasfactory/metering/common |
70 | 7 |
EventBridgeEvent.java in src/main/java/com/amazonaws/partners/saasfactory/metering/common |
39 | 8 |
AggregationEntry.java in src/main/java/com/amazonaws/partners/saasfactory/metering/common |
29 | 2 |
OnboardingEvent.java in src/main/java/com/amazonaws/partners/saasfactory/metering/common |
28 | 4 |
TableConfiguration.java in src/main/java/com/amazonaws/partners/saasfactory/metering/common |
15 | 3 |
EventBridgeBillingEventDetail.java in src/main/java/com/amazonaws/partners/saasfactory/metering/common |
14 | 2 |
EventBridgeOnboardTenantEventDetail.java in src/main/java/com/amazonaws/partners/saasfactory/metering/common |
14 | 2 |
BillingProviderConfiguration.java in src/main/java/com/amazonaws/partners/saasfactory/metering/common |
13 | 3 |
EventBridgeBillingEvent.java in src/main/java/com/amazonaws/partners/saasfactory/metering/common |
9 | 2 |
EventBridgeOnboardTenantEvent.java in src/main/java/com/amazonaws/partners/saasfactory/metering/common |
9 | 2 |
ProcessBillingEventException.java in src/main/java/com/amazonaws/partners/saasfactory/metering/common |
6 | 1 |
TenantNotFoundException.java in src/main/java/com/amazonaws/partners/saasfactory/metering/common |
6 | 1 |
TenantOnboardingException.java in src/main/java/com/amazonaws/partners/saasfactory/metering/common |
6 | 1 |
File | # lines | # units |
---|---|---|
BillingEventAggregation.java in src/main/java/com/amazonaws/partners/saasfactory/metering/aggregation |
317 | 11 |
StripeBillingPublish.java in src/main/java/com/amazonaws/partners/saasfactory/metering/aggregation |
337 | 10 |
Constants.java in src/main/java/com/amazonaws/partners/saasfactory/metering/common |
119 | 8 |
EventBridgeEvent.java in src/main/java/com/amazonaws/partners/saasfactory/metering/common |
39 | 8 |
BillingEvent.java in src/main/java/com/amazonaws/partners/saasfactory/metering/common |
70 | 7 |
TenantConfiguration.java in src/main/java/com/amazonaws/partners/saasfactory/metering/common |
162 | 7 |
ProcessBillingEvent.java in src/main/java/com/amazonaws/partners/saasfactory/metering/billing |
139 | 5 |
OnboardNewTenant.java in src/main/java/com/amazonaws/partners/saasfactory/metering/onboarding |
113 | 5 |
OnboardingEvent.java in src/main/java/com/amazonaws/partners/saasfactory/metering/common |
28 | 4 |
BillingProviderConfiguration.java in src/main/java/com/amazonaws/partners/saasfactory/metering/common |
13 | 3 |
TableConfiguration.java in src/main/java/com/amazonaws/partners/saasfactory/metering/common |
15 | 3 |
EventBridgeBillingEventDetail.java in src/main/java/com/amazonaws/partners/saasfactory/metering/common |
14 | 2 |
EventBridgeBillingEvent.java in src/main/java/com/amazonaws/partners/saasfactory/metering/common |
9 | 2 |
EventBridgeOnboardTenantEventDetail.java in src/main/java/com/amazonaws/partners/saasfactory/metering/common |
14 | 2 |
EventBridgeOnboardTenantEvent.java in src/main/java/com/amazonaws/partners/saasfactory/metering/common |
9 | 2 |
AggregationEntry.java in src/main/java/com/amazonaws/partners/saasfactory/metering/common |
29 | 2 |
ProcessBillingEventException.java in src/main/java/com/amazonaws/partners/saasfactory/metering/common |
6 | 1 |
TenantNotFoundException.java in src/main/java/com/amazonaws/partners/saasfactory/metering/common |
6 | 1 |
TenantOnboardingException.java in src/main/java/com/amazonaws/partners/saasfactory/metering/common |
6 | 1 |
There are 5 files with lines longer than 120 characters. In total, there are 20 long lines.
File | # lines | # units | # long lines |
---|---|---|---|
BillingEventAggregation.java in src/main/java/com/amazonaws/partners/saasfactory/metering/aggregation |
317 | 11 | 6 |
OnboardNewTenant.java in src/main/java/com/amazonaws/partners/saasfactory/metering/onboarding |
113 | 5 | 5 |
StripeBillingPublish.java in src/main/java/com/amazonaws/partners/saasfactory/metering/aggregation |
337 | 10 | 4 |
TenantConfiguration.java in src/main/java/com/amazonaws/partners/saasfactory/metering/common |
162 | 7 | 3 |
ProcessBillingEvent.java in src/main/java/com/amazonaws/partners/saasfactory/metering/billing |
139 | 5 | 2 |